Which Planet Governs Aquarius?

When it comes to the zodiac sign Aquarius, one cannot overlook the influence of the ruling planet. Astrologically, each sign is assigned a ruling planet that carries specific energies and characteristics. In the case of Aquarius, the ruling planet is Uranus.

The Ruling Planet of Aquarius

Aquarius is governed by Uranus, the planet associated with creativity, rebellion, and unpredictable events. Uranus embodies the very essence of Aquarius’ nontraditional approach to life. Just as Aquarians are known for their individuality, Uranus celebrates uniqueness and originality.

Uranus is often referred to as the “Awakener” because its energy disrupts established norms and introduces new and revolutionary ideas. It inspires change and a fresh perspective on life. Aquarius individuals, under the influence of Uranus, possess a strong desire to challenge the status quo and bring about societal progress.

Unveiling Uranus: The Planet Governing Aquarius

Uranus, the seventh planet from the Sun, is a gas giant with a distinct blue-green color. It was discovered in 1781 by astronomer William Herschel and is one of the most intriguing celestial bodies in our solar system.

In astrology, Uranus represents innovation, technology, and intellectual pursuits. It encourages unconventional thinking and a willingness to embrace change. Aquarius individuals strongly resonate with these qualities, often displaying a natural affinity for cutting-edge ideas, scientific exploration, and advancements in various fields.

Other Astrological Factors Affecting Aquarius

In addition to Uranus, several other astrological factors influence Aquarius individuals. These factors include the ruling house and modality associated with the sign.

Aquarius is associated with the eleventh house, which is commonly associated with community, social groups, and aspirations. This placement reinforces Aquarius’ focus on collective progress and working towards a more inclusive and equal society.

As for modality, Aquarius belongs to the fixed modality along with Taurus, Leo, and Scorpio. This means that Aquarius individuals have a stable and determined nature, often exhibiting unwavering dedication to their causes and beliefs.
